Package org.immutables.value.processor
Class Modifiables
- java.lang.Object
-
- org.immutables.generator.Builtins
-
- org.immutables.generator.AbstractTemplate
-
- org.immutables.value.processor.AbstractValuesTemplate
-
- org.immutables.value.processor.ValuesTemplate
-
- org.immutables.value.processor.Modifiables
-
- Direct Known Subclasses:
Generator_Modifiables
@Template abstract class Modifiables extends ValuesTemplate
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class org.immutables.value.processor.AbstractValuesTemplate
AbstractValuesTemplate.Flag, AbstractValuesTemplate.TrackingSet
-
Nested classes/interfaces inherited from class org.immutables.generator.Builtins
Builtins.Literal
-
-
Field Summary
Fields Modifier and Type Field Description (package private) Immutablesim(package private) com.google.common.base.Predicate<java.lang.String>setTopLevelSimple-
Fields inherited from class org.immutables.value.processor.ValuesTemplate
values
-
Fields inherited from class org.immutables.value.processor.AbstractValuesTemplate
allowsClasspathAnnotation, asDiamond, atFallbackNullable, Attribute, BitPosition, CLASSNAME_TAG_JAXARTA, docEscaped, flag, guava, HasStyleInfo, LongPositions, longsFor, noAttributes, Package, Type
-
Fields inherited from class org.immutables.generator.AbstractTemplate
classpath, output
-
-
Constructor Summary
Constructors Constructor Description Modifiables()
-
Method Summary
-
Methods inherited from class org.immutables.value.processor.ValuesTemplate
generate, inferJaxarta, usingValues
-
Methods inherited from class org.immutables.value.processor.AbstractValuesTemplate
jaxarta, newTrackingSet, setJaxarta
-
Methods inherited from class org.immutables.generator.AbstractTemplate
annotations, processing, round
-
-
-
-
Field Detail
-
im
final Immutables im
-
setTopLevelSimple
final com.google.common.base.Predicate<java.lang.String> setTopLevelSimple
-
-